Voters Are Set To Decide A Hard-Fought Democratic Primary In Ohio
The race pits Nina Turner, an ally of Bernie Sanders and the so-called Squad, against Shontel Brown, who has endorsements from Hillary Clinton and James Clyburn. The contest could be close.
by Danielle Kurtzleben
Aug 03, 2021
2 minutes
A hard-fought primary wraps up Tuesday in Ohio's 11th Congressional District, a race that has seen national Democrats descend on the Cleveland area to take sides as two competing factions of the party fight for a historic Democratic seat.
While 13 people are on the ballot, two have emerged at the front of the pack:
- Shontel Brown, the Cuyahoga County Democratic Party chair and a county councilwoman;
